Picasso the stranger
The exhibition Picasso the stranger, organized by the Rome Foundation in collaboration with Marsilio Arte, will open at Palazzo Cipolla from 27 February 2025 and will be visible until 29 June. Created by Annie Cohen-Solal, the exhibition explores the artist’s identity as an immigrant in France, where, despite his worldwide fame, he never obtained citizenship. A journey that combines aesthetics and politics to tell how Picasso revolutionized twentieth-century art by living the condition of a “foreigner”.
